Heirs Press For Restitution For One Of Austria’s Most Iconic Artworks

“Over the last decade, Austria has made significant progress in restoring art and property looted by the Nazis during World War II. Now the government’s commitment to that goal is facing a new test, with the filing of a claim on Tuesday for the return of one of the nation’s most celebrated artworks: the Beethoven Frieze, by Gustav Klimt.
